A variety's yield represents the volume of produce harvested per unit area and is categorized into potential, projected, biological, and actual yield. It manifests as the result of the plant's genetic capabilities being realized, limited by external environmental conditions and the effectiveness of applied agricultural practices.
This indicator depends on the suitability of the variety to soil and climatic conditions, the level of agronomy, the quality of preceding crops, and genotype stability. Assessing yield structure includes an analysis of stand density, tillering, number of grains or tubers, and thousand kernel weight, which allows for the determination of productivity formation factors.
For accurate variety comparison during variety trials, indicators are adjusted to standard moisture content and correlated with a control variety standard. When selecting a variety, ecological plasticity, yield variability across different years, and statistical significance of data, expressed through the least significant difference, are taken into account.
